I have a couple old NAS units - a Buffalo link station and a Lenovo ix2-dl
Both are linux under the hood - and you can enable SSH - so both to a certain level are hackable.
The buffalo one only comes with CIFS built in- and only version 1 of cifs, so its very antiquated.
however, i've been able to enable NFS with a ansible playbook by installing ipkg, nfs, portmapper, etc ...
